Average Annual Savings From Solar Panels Revealed
Well, let's dive straight into the numbers that matter. According to the 2023 National Renewable Energy Lab Report, U.S. homeowners typically save $1,200-$1,600 annually by switching to solar. But wait, no - that's not entirely accurate for all cases. Your actual savings depend on three crucial factors:
- Current electricity rates in your area (avg. $0.23/kWh nationally)
- Available sunlight hours (Arizona vs. Maine difference: 300+ hours/year)
- Federal/state incentives (26% tax credit extended through 2032)
State | Avg. System Size | First-Year Savings | 25-Year Projection |
---|---|---|---|
California | 7 kW | $1,800 | $54,000 |
Texas | 8.5 kW | $1,250 | $37,500 |
New York | 6 kW | $1,100 | $33,000 |

4 Factors That Make or Break Your Savings
Here's where things get interesting. The Department of Energy's Residential Solar Index shows 23% variance in savings based on:
- Peak vs. Off-Peak Usage: Time-of-use rates can boost savings by 18% if you optimize
- Net Metering Policies: 38 states offer full retail credit for excess energy
- Panel Degradation: Modern systems lose only 0.5% efficiency/year vs. 1% in 2010s
- Roof Orientation: South-facing roofs in Northern Hemisphere yield 15% more output
Batteries: Game-Changer or Money Pit?
Imagine if you could store that extra solar juice for nighttime use. Tesla Powerwall installations increased 140% last quarter, but are they worth it?
- Upfront cost: $12,000-$16,000 per battery
- Potential savings boost: 30-40% in areas with frequent outages
- Break-even period: 8-12 years vs. 6-8 years for panels alone
Actually, the sweet spot seems to be partial battery backup. A 2024 EnergySage survey found 68% of users with 10-15 kWh storage reported optimal savings.
Solar Financing: Cash vs. Loan vs. Lease
This is where many homeowners get ratio'd by fine print. Let's unpack the options:
Method | Upfront Cost | Long-Term Savings | Tax Credit Eligible |
---|---|---|---|
Cash Purchase | $15k-$25k | $35k-$50k | Yes |
Solar Loan | $0 down | $18k-$30k | Yes |
PPA Lease | $0 down | $5k-$15k | No |
Wait, no - lease agreements have improved recently. SunPower's new Flex Plan offers 10% guaranteed savings from Day 1 with escalator clauses capped at 2.9%.
The Maintenance Myth
"Will I spend my savings on repairs?" Good news: Modern systems require minimal upkeep:
- Inverter replacement: 1x every 10-15 years ($1,500-$2,000)
- Panel cleaning: 2-4x/year ($0 if DIY)
- Monitoring apps: Included free with most installs
As we approach Q4 2024, manufacturers are rolling out 30-year comprehensive warranties - a huge upgrade from the 10-year standard in 2015.
